Bagikan melalui


ITfLangBarItemButton::Metode GetIcon (ctfutb.h)

Mendapatkan ikon yang akan ditampilkan untuk tombol bilah bahasa.

Sintaks

HRESULT GetIcon(
  [out] HICON *phIcon
);

Parameter

[out] phIcon

Penunjuk ke nilai HICON yang menerima handel ikon. Menerima NULL jika tombol tidak memiliki ikon. Pemanggil harus membebaskan ikon ini ketika tidak lagi diperlukan dengan memanggil DestroyIcon.

Mengembalikan nilai

Metode ini dapat mengembalikan salah satu nilai ini.

Nilai Deskripsi
S_OK
Metode berhasil.
E_INVALIDARG
phIcon tidak valid.

Keterangan

Ukuran ideal ikon dapat diperoleh dengan memanggil GetSystemMetrics(SM_CXSMICON) untuk lebar ikon dan GetSystemMetrics(SM_CYSMICON) untuk tinggi ikon.

Jika tombol memiliki gaya TF_LBI_STYLE_TEXTCOLORICON, ikon yang diperoleh oleh metode ini harus menjadi ikon monokrom.

Persyaratan

   
Klien minimum yang didukung Windows 2000 Professional [hanya aplikasi desktop]
Server minimum yang didukung Windows 2000 Server [hanya aplikasi desktop]
Target Platform Windows
Header ctfutb.h
DLL Msctf.dll
Redistribusi TSF 1.0 di Windows 2000 Professional